需求之浅谈

             机房收费系统经过二十天的时间算是完成了,虽说是完成,但只是实现了其中的功能,我们都知道一个完整的软件其前期的需求分析才是很重要的部分,只要需求分析好了,代码可以说是很简单并且是用时最少的一个阶段,师傅说我们第一遍敲机房,现在对需求的理解还不是很深刻,实现其功能就可以,需求在接下来的学习中会学习的,不过我还是想简单的谈一下,说一下我现在阶段对需求的理解。

    我的理解就是用户对此软件的期望,用户希望软件能最大限度地方便他的生活,用最少的流程、最少的时间来到达他想要的效果。

机房中涉及到的需求:

一、关于提示

1、在设计的过程中,我们要求有些文本框只可以输入数字、有些只可以输入汉字或字符,为了防止输入错误内容,我们会设置提示,那么问题来了,提示什么时候会更好那??


     你会在要输入时提示吗?

     有很多用户是知道这个框是只能输入数字的,如果在输入时弹出一个框,然后还得点击确定,就会让人觉得很烦,你觉得那。。。

     你会在所有的信息都填写完了,点击确定的时候提示你输入的格式不正确吗?

     我在用软件的时候的一个感受,比如说注册,马上确定之后就完成了,突然出来一个框说你哪 哪写的不对,就会让我心里失落一下,也许这时候对此软件的好感就降低了一点,会有同样的感受吗。。。 

所以,,,我认为最好的提示时间便是在用户输入之后,如果不对就立刻提示,如果输入正确,就没有必要提示了!


组合查询的时候会有上下机日期、注册日期、注销日期等,要求日期的格式,所以我在每次单击日期时设计了提示,每次我运行这块是也觉得挺烦的,老提示,后来验收时师傅也提到了这个问题,虽然这些提示都是小问题,但反映了一个大问题,我们没有从用户的角度思考问题,这是做软件最基本的要求!



其实,如果想要更好的为用户服务,在选择了日期时,文本框中应该弹出一个日历,直接选择就可以,节省了用户的时间,也避免了输入的烦恼。







二、关于默认选项

以注册为例:

其中涉及到性别、状态、类型三个可选项,在验收时师傅建议我默认选项,其实之前学生的时候,就提到过这个问题,我当时想默认一个,不也有不是这个选项的,不还得选,要从另一个角度考虑问题:首先要考虑用户中那个选项使用率比较高,然后默认其中一个,就为大多数用户节约了时间,一个用户三秒钟,那所用的那??




总结:类似于这样的问题,机房中有很多,我提到的这些在我们的意识里都是小问题,稍微改一下,就可以实现,但我想说的是即使再简单,有没有想到就是一个大问题,从这些小的细节也告诉我们要从不同的角度思考问题,横看成岭侧成峰,远近高低各不同!加油!





评论 25
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值